I strongly believe that children should do household

chores because it brings them many benefits. First


of all, doing chores helps children develop a sense
of responsibility. When they clean their room, wash
the dishes, or take out the trash, they learn that all
the members in the family are responsible for
keeping the house tidy, not just their parents.
Secondly, household chores teach children some
important life skills that will be useful when they
grow up, such as cooking, washing or organizing
things. In addition, when children help their parents,
family relationships become closer and warmer
because they spend more time together. Finally,
doing chores helps children understand how hard
their parents work and encourages them to
appreciate their efforts. For all these reasons, I think
that children should definitely do household chores
at home.
